** The Chevrolet repair market serving Green Creek, NJ, is characterized by a handful of highly competent, independent shops located primarily in the nearby commercial hub of Cape May Court House. There are no new-car Chevrolet dealerships in the immediate vicinity, creating a niche for these independent specialists. The competition is moderate but of generally high quality, with shops competing on reputation, specialized knowledge, and personalized customer service rather than price alone. The local customer base consists of a mix of year-round residents and seasonal owners, leading to a demand for both reliable daily driver maintenance and performance/classic vehicle care. Typical pricing for labor is competitive for the Southern New Jersey region, generally ranging from $110 to $150 per hour. Common questions about chevrolet repair services in Green Creek, NJ
Given our coastal proximity and seasonal weather, common issues include brake corrosion from salt air, electrical problems from humidity affecting sensors, and suspension wear from rural road conditions. For specific models, local shops often see Equinox and Silverado owners for check engine lights related to fuel systems or exhaust sensors.
Look for shops with GM or Chevrolet-specific certifications (like ASE with GM training) and seek recommendations from local community groups or neighbors in Cape May County. A quality shop will use genuine GM parts or high-quality OEM equivalents and have experience with the common models driven in our area.
Labor rates in Green Creek and surrounding Cape May County are often competitive, but parts availability can sometimes influence cost and timeline. Building a relationship with a local independent specialist can be more cost-effective than the dealerships farther away in Vineland or Atlantic City for routine repairs.
Seek immediate service for warning lights like brake or oil pressure, unusual noises after driving on sandy or wet backroads, or if you experience performance loss—common after seasonal storms. Schedule routine checks before summer and winter for A/C, heating, and tire rotations to handle our variable coastal climate.
Yes, the salty air and humidity necessitate more frequent undercarriage washes and brake inspections to prevent corrosion. Also, preparing your vehicle for seasonal tourist traffic and occasional flooding on low-lying roads near the creek is advised, making tire and electrical system checks vital.
